Vettel runner-up, Raikkonen fifth at Sochi

Sebastian takes second in the Drivers’ standings Sochi – At the end of the 53 laps of the Russian Grand Prix, Sebastian Vettel came home in second place. This result moves the German up to second in the Drivers’ classification. This Russian podium is Vettel’s eleventh of the season. There were tense moments all the way to the end for Kimi Raikkonen, who took the chequered flag in fifth place, having collided with fellow countryman Valtteri Bottas on the final lap. Lewis Hamilton won the race for Mercedes. Kimi Raikkonen: “So far, it has been a compromise weekend because of the weather and many other things that happened.
